snrg.net
当前位置:首页 >> php mysqli连接数据库 >>

php mysqli连接数据库

一、mysql与mysqli的概念相关:1、mysql与mysqli都是php方面的函数集,与mysql数据库关联不大.2、在php5版本之前,一般是用php的mysql函数去驱动mysql数据库的,比如mysql_query()的函数,属于面向过程3、在php5版本以后,增加

mysqli没有提供一个特殊的方法用于打开持久化连接.需要打开一个持久化连接时,你必须在 连接时在主机名前增加p:.

PHP 如何连接MySQL数据库:<?php // mysql_connect(服务器,用户名,密码) $link = mysql_connect("localhost","root","root"); // mysql_select_db(数据库,$link) $db_selected = mysql_select_db("clothes",$link); // 编码格式(貌似很重要) mysql_query("set names 'utf8'");?>

Mysqli是php5之后才有的功能,没有开启扩展的朋友可以打开您的php.ini的配置文件.查找下面的语句:;extension=php_mysqli.dll将其修改为:extension=php_mysqli.dll即可. 相对于mysql有很多新的特性和优势 (1)支持本地绑定、准备(prepare)等语法 (2)执行sql语句的错误代码 (3)同时执行多个sql (4)另外提供了面向对象的调用接口的方法.

一:mysqli.dll是一个允许以对象的方式或者过程操作数据库的,它的使用方式也很容易.这里就几个常见的操作和mysql.dll做一个对比. 1:mysql.dll(可以理解为函数式的方式): $conn = mysql_connect('localhost', 'user', 'password'); //连接

PHP链接数据库有几种方式mysqli:$servername = "localhost"; $username = "username"; $password = "password"; // 创建连接 $conn = new mysqli($servername, $username, $password); // 检测连接 if ($conn->connect_error) {die(

$username = $_POST['username'];$password = $_POST['password'];$password1 = $_POST['password1'];$email = $_POST['mail'];//判断用户名if(empty($username)){ exit('用户名不能为空');}//判断密码if(empty($password)){ exit('密码不能

php连接查询数据库的一般步骤如下:$con=mysqli_connect("localhost","root","123456","dbname"); $sql="SELECT name FROM web";$result=mysqli_query($con,$sql);//mysqli_fetch_array是从 结果集 中取得一行作为数字数组或关联数组/*你可以先var_dump一下你的结果集 var_dump($result);看是否为空.如果为空就不关mysqli_fetch_array的事了,你要检查的就是sql语句.*/$row=mysqli_fetch_array($result);

mysql_connect('数据库连接地址','用户名','密码');//连接mysqlmysql_select_db('数据库名');//选择需要的数据库举个栗子:$sql = "select * from ceshi";$query = mysql_query($sql);$arr = mysql_fetch_assoc($query);

mysqli:新的mysql : 旧的

网站首页 | 网站地图
All rights reserved Powered by www.snrg.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com